The Evolution of Aprilia’s Tuono 660 Factory

As 2025 approaches, motorcycle enthusiasts are excited about the revamped Aprilia Tuono 660 Factory. This middleweight naked bike is not just a pretty face; it’s packing some serious improvements under the hood. With an upgraded engine, riders can expect not just speed, but a throaty roar that will turn heads and ignite adrenaline.

Upgraded Engine Performance

Perhaps the crown jewel of the 2025 iteration is its enhanced engine performance. Aprilia has fine-tuned the power delivery to provide better torque characteristics, which means you can grab the throttle and feel the bike respond perfectly. No more lag, just smooth acceleration that gives even the most seasoned riders a reason to smile. And let’s be honest, who doesn’t love that?

Öhlins Finery: A Touch of Luxury

Adding to the overall experience are the Öhlins components that grace this beauty. The premium suspension setup ensures that whether you’re carving through canyons or cruising the city streets, the ride is plush yet responsive. It’s like sitting on a cloud that can also do 0 to 60 faster than you can say ‘Tuono’. With these enhancements, the Aprilia Tuono 660 Factory promises to deliver a thrilling ride that’s hard to resist.
